In our park, people think their properties are worth so much more than they really are. They bought their lots dirt cheap, then put a travel trailer or park model on them. In some cases the park models are like a travel trailer with tip outs, 80's models, etc. Then they started adding on to the point that it would not be recognizable as a trailer. Some do look very nice, but it is a trailer that's been added on to. They want a price that resembles what you would ask for a stick built home. That's why nothing is selling here. They probably don't have $15,000-20,000 invested and they want 3-4 times that. No way to get around it, an RV does not appreciate in value. . . even if you add on to it.
